Located at 9 Jolley Street, Woolner, <strong>Darwin</strong><br />

Recycling is a local recycling specialist <strong>and</strong><br />

scrap yard for non-ferrous metal needs. With the<br />

largest stripping machine in <strong>Northern</strong> Australia,<br />

nicknamed “Kermit” for its bright green colour,<br />

<strong>Darwin</strong> Recycling can strip <strong>and</strong> separate plastic<br />

from copper wire <strong>and</strong> steel armoured cable.<br />

Recycled plastic goes in to making lightweight<br />

pavers as a substitute for s<strong>and</strong>.<br />

“When you recycle with <strong>Darwin</strong> Recyclers, rest<br />

assured that your copper <strong>and</strong> plastic that Kermit<br />

eats or processes is not going to l<strong>and</strong>fill.” said<br />

owner-operator, Gerard “Frenchy” French, a former<br />

tourism operator who saw an opportunity in<br />

recycling five years ago, starting with cables <strong>and</strong><br />

exp<strong>and</strong>ing to include all non-ferrous materials.<br />

Buying used batteries <strong>and</strong> all non-ferrous scrap<br />

metals for recycling including copper, cables,<br />

stainless steel, used batteries, electrical cables,<br />

electric motors, radiators, air conditioning units,<br />

brass, bronze <strong>and</strong> aluminium, <strong>Darwin</strong> Recycling<br />

provides a helpful <strong>and</strong> friendly service to both<br />

domestic <strong>and</strong> commercial customers, paying cash<br />

at the scales.<br />
